Chapter 10 Web of Deceit

Three weeks After.

"You're mine... There's no escaping from that," he uttered, tightening his grip on me.

His scent reeked of alcohol; precisely, he was drunk.

His eyes darkened with desire as he shoved me onto the bed, pinning me down.

I tried resisting, but it was of no use; his brute strength was too much for me to resist.

He callously took what he wanted, leaving my body aching as he fell to the other side of the bed, asleep.

It had only been three weeks since we had traveled, following his plan not to draw too much attention.

But these three weeks had been a hard time for me; I was just his tool, a tool of desire meant to entice him, nothing else.

Still, the truth lies; I knew what I was getting myself into when I signed the contract.

I had it all, so why? Why do I feel like I've just been used? I mean, this was a gain-gain for both of us.

He had managed to secure a job for me at Kensington Global Innovation within a blink during the weeks-a job I had been pushing through for many years, and he made it happen without a single stress.

I had the power, the money, so why?

His hands landed on me in a cradle as my body quivered a bit.

He was asleep; he came back drunk tonight. Even with this week's attempts to study him, it just seems impossible.

Since he booked this hotel and suggested we move to a city for some weeks, he hardly stays.

He comes back in the night, drunk, grabs me, uses me as his pleasure tool, then falls asleep.

I saw myself as nothing more useful than sex in his eyes.

With my thoughts absorbing me, I found myself falling asleep.

The next morning came, and my eyes caught him dressing, wearing his clothes and suit.

His eyes focused on mine. "Get dressed; we're returning to the city..." he uttered.

What brought about this sudden change of mind? He suggested we stay for a month, but now he suddenly had a change of heart.

"Come on." He uttered, snapping me out of my thoughts.

He was quite in a hurry to get back; surely something must have come up.

I slowly stood up with slow, gentle steps, making my way to the bathtub.

While washing myself, I could hear his voice; it seemed he was on a call.

"Secure the package; I'm on my way to fix the deal..." he uttered.

"What package and deal? Maybe it was about his company."

I cradled my body with soap, washing every inch. As I finished bathing, I came out, drying my brown curly hair. I could feel his unflinching gaze on me as he sat on the couch.

Done drying my hair, I reached for my cupboard, grabbing some clothes as I released my towels. His gaze remained unyielding as it fixed on my body with enticement, which only made me uneasy.

"What brought about this change of mind?" I asked, trying to shift the focus.

"Let's just say some things came up..." he uttered briefly.

He hardly revealed much; whenever I brought up questions, he would always cut me off with a few words.

But I wanted more; I wanted to know more than I did, but he was secretive.

As I finished dressing, I packed a few of my clothes into my luggage as he stood up.

"Let's go," he uttered, spinning his car keys on his fingertips before pocketing them in his trousers.

We exited the hotel, the Golden Fountain Hotel-one of the top 5-star hotels and most expensive.

I would never have guessed I'd be here, renting a high-end room.

His car was parked in the hotel's parking lot as we walked towards it, and he entered with me following.

He drove off, leaving the hotel and driving back to the city. He uttered no words throughout the drive, his eyes fixed on the road while I went through my phone, browsing through some content.

"You shall resume your role at Kensington Global Innovation tomorrow..." he said, breaking the silence.

I couldn't wait; my dream job awaited me tomorrow. I calmly nodded, "Alright...", precisely hiding how happy I was. This was a first step.

I aimed for greater heights. When I would become the next great success story, maybe then my parents would see their mistake in denying me their attention, giving it all to Evelyn.

With the evening setting in, we finally arrived back in the city, taking in the air after weeks of being away.

He parked the car beside a restaurant, leaving me curious.

"Aren't we going to your mansion?" I asked.

"I am here to meet a friend... Alexander Knightbridge, and he will also be your boss tomorrow at Kensington Global Innovation...."

His words shook me. I was meeting the current CEO of Kensington Global Innovation. How surprising could this get?

But damn, how could he not inform me?

I straightened my clothes properly, checking my face.

It seemed I understood why it was so easy for him to secure a job for me at Kensington Global Innovation, given his friendship with their boss.

"Go on in..." he said.

"Aren't you coming in along?"

"I will park the car first, then come in...." he uttered.

I sighed wordlessly as I stepped out of the car. Without hesitation, he drove off as I gently walked into the restaurant.

My eyes flickered around the area searching for Alexander Knightbridge, finally catching sight of him seated, wearing a blue coat with a lady seated beside him. I guessed that must be his girlfriend or fiancée, but yeah, I bothered less. He was quite handsome, just as seen in the newspapers.

Lost in awe of my thoughts, I was snapped by Sebastian's tap. "Let's go..." he said with a soft grip on my wrist. "And remember, we are a couple, so..."

He held my hand as we walked toward the table where Alexander Knightbridge was seated.

As we arrived, Sebastian gently pulled a seat for me, offering it romantically, making me feel uneasy as I wasn't used to his fake act.

I sat as he sat beside me with a smile.

"Waiter...." he called out, ordering some food.

His eyes caught mine politely, asking me what I wanted, leaving my response empty.

Mr. Knightbridge's presumed girlfriend requested water. Well, I guess it was expected; she seemed classy, her clothes of high design with heavy makeup.

As the air was consumed by Sebastian and Mr. Knightbridge's conversation, mostly focused on business and shareholders in the company, they discussed some deals, and my eyes slowly drifted to my phone screen settings, bored from it all.

I decided to take a break for some air, leaving the table and going into the restaurant's restroom.

My eyes fixed on my reflection as my hands adjusted my hair with a soft touch. I checked my lipstick.

I decided to stay for some minutes before returning to the table, but as I turned to open the door, I was stunned by Alexander Knightbridge walking in.

I released my grip on the door, stepping back as he entered.

He turned on the sink pipe, washing his hands and wiping them with his handkerchief.

I just stood there and watched, my body anxiously up...

His gaze turned towards me, "So, how long have you and Sebastian been together?" he questioned.

His question shook me, causing me to stammer, "Hmmm," I uttered, recollecting my thoughts.

"Oh, was it love at first sight?" he cut in, as I nodded yes, unsure of what to say.

He let out a slight chuckle, "It was business that brought Sebastian Hawthorne and me together. But, since I've known him, he didn't seem like someone who would fall in love. So, it was quite shocking to find out he had someone and was even married. I must say, wow."

It appeared the truth was indeed just between Sebastian and me. It seemed he also didn't inform Alexander Knightbridge. I was quite sure Mr. Knightbridge was his only friend, and Sebastian had trust issues.

Lost in my thoughts, I noticed Alexander Knightbridge getting closer, his steps moving slowly as he approached me.

"So, do you also love him? Do you love Sebastian Hawthorne, or are you just here for the money?" he whispered, his breath nearly mingling with mine as he cradled my cheek.

"I mean, if it's the money... I am here, though," he whispered, his eyes leaving an enticing gaze.

I was his friend's wife; well, it was just a contract, but to him, it was real. And he had a fiancée, or so I supposed.

His steps grew closer, his gaze fixed, his lips getting nearer.

"I am sorry, I have to go..." I said, pushing him away slightly as I left, craving fresh air.

What was that?

I let out a sigh, my mind set on leaving.

I walked toward the table, but I found no one seated there. Sebastian wasn't there, nor was Alexander's girlfriend.

I walked around the area, searching for Sebastian. Then, I caught sight of him on the side of the restaurant, his phone on his ear.

I sensed he was on a call as I walked towards him, hoping to convince him that I wanted to leave.

I needed some space, especially after what had just transpired at the restroom with Alexander Knightbridge.

As I approached Sebastian, his words caught my attention.

My ears could hear what he was saying, "Take care of everything, Darius. The word mustn't get out, and if things get out of hand, inform Nikolai. I want them dead..."

His words shocked me.

"Dead..." I whispered.

I could sense the pause in his conversation as he slowly turned his gaze. I hid myself beside the wall, away from his sight.

After a few seconds of silence, his words continued on the phone as he walked further away from my direction.

My mind ached with curiosity about who Sebastian truly was and who he wanted dead...
